dc.description.abstractWe give an analytical expression for the gap-to- Tc ratio (R) of a superconductor with a van Hove singularity in the density of states. Our calculation yields R in very good agreement with the results obtained numerically by S. Ratanaburi et al. [J. Supercond. 9, 485 (1996)]. © 1998 Plenum Publishing Corporation.
